  • Patent number: 9466014
    Abstract: The systems and methods of the present disclosure use a mobile device equipped with a camera to capture and preprocess images of objects including financial documents, financial cards, and identification cards, and to recognize information in the images of the objects. The methods include detecting quadrangles in images of an object in an image data stream generated by the camera, capturing a first image, transforming the first image, binarizing the transformed image, recognizing information in the binarized image, and determining the validity of the recognized information. The method also includes communicating with a server of a financial institution or other organization to determine the validity of the recognized information.

  • Patent number: 9152617
    Abstract: A system, method, and computer program product for processing of objects are disclosed. A processor coupled to a graphical user interface is configured to display an object. The processor receives input from a user concerning the object, wherein input relates to at least a partial location of the object, as a mouse position close to the object, a line approximately covering the vertical or horizontal extent of the object, or a box approximately covering the object. The processor provides input to a keying module, wherein the keying module processes the received input and provides the input to a recognition engine. The recognition engine is in communication with the keying module. Based on the received input, the recognition engine provides an exact information concerning the received input to the keying module, as an exact location, a recognition result, and a confidence score qualifying the reliability of the recognition results.
